Ordinals
beta
Sat 1337220805845540
decimal
324888.805845540
degree
0°114888′312″805845540‴
percentile
63.67718130078494%
name
ejlqtbtafrx
cycle
0
epoch
1
period
161
block
324888
offset
805845540
timestamp
2014-10-11 19:29:56 UTC
rarity
common
prev
next